Are the crowds worse in mid-May than April? I purposely planned a solo trip for mid-May thinking it would be less crowded than March or April because spring breaks would be over with, but kids wouldn't be out of school for the summer yet. Was I wrong? According the Unofficial Guide crowds levels are moderately heavy the first three weeks of April and very light the last week of April and all of May except for May 27-31 when they're very crowded. FYI: March 26-27, 2005 (Easter weekend) is listed as exceedingly crowded-jam packed.

Kim:

We've gone two years in a row the first and second weeks of May and we think it's a GREAT time to go!

The weather is usually quite good, although this year, there was a heat wave that hit on the 19th, our last day.

It's Value season, so the prices are good.

And our experience is very low crowds (except Mondays at MK) For both trips, most lines were from 0-10 minutes and the longest were a 25 minute wait for Jungle Cruise and 30 for Splash Mountain.

April is tough because of Spring Break, so I think you guys will be better off in May.

We went this past May from the 12th to the 22nd. Got all the PS' we wanted with no problems and the crowds really weren't bad at all. I think the longest wait was 25-30 minutes. Weather was absolutely wonderful, mid 80's everyday and very pleasant at night. Even the waterparks were not crowded!! MGM had Star Wars weekend and wasn't really crowded either. Epcot had the Flower Festival, which was so beautiful. We are planning our next trip again around the same time in May 2005 (hoping for 2004).
